Cellulite creams promise smoother skin by targeting dimpled thighs and buttocks through topical ingredients that claim to improve circulation and break down fat. Many people use these products as part of a daily skincare routine, hoping for visible improvements without medical procedures.
Before spending on popular formulas, it helps to understand how these products work in practice, what the labels really mean, and how results compare to clinical treatments. The table below summarizes key expectations, typical timelines, and realistic outcomes for users of cellulite creams.

How Cellulite Creams Work on Skin
Many cellulite creams rely on ingredients like caffeine, retinol, peptides, and herbal extracts that aim to improve blood flow and support collagen production. When you massage these products into the skin, they temporarily increase surface fullness and may make dimples less noticeable for a short period.
The heat from your hands during application encourages microcirculation, which creates a plumping effect that resembles a mild lifting action. While this can enhance skin texture, it does not remove the structural fat pockets that form deeper layers of cellulite.
Key Ingredients and Their Roles
Formulators choose specific active compounds to address different aspects of cellulite appearance, from fluid retention to loss of firmness. Understanding these components can help you set realistic expectations about what a cream can achieve.
Caffeine and circulation
Caffeine temporarily dehydrates fat cells, reducing water retention and creating a smoother surface that lasts hours rather than days.

Realistic Timelines and Results
Users often notice a tighter feel immediately after application, especially when products contain warming agents or light-reflecting particles. Visible changes in skin firmness typically require several weeks of regular use, and major transformation is uncommon without additional treatments.
Genetics, hormone levels, and lifestyle factors such as hydration, movement, and diet strongly influence how well any topical product performs. Pairing consistent topical care with strength training and adequate water intake can enhance overall skin tone.
How to Use Creams Effectively
- Apply to clean, dry skin and massage in upward circles toward the heart.
- Use consistently for at least several weeks before judging results.
- Combine with dry brushing or light massage to encourage temporary circulation.
- Track changes with photos to compare subtle differences over time.

Do cellulite creams actually reduce the appearance of dimples?
They can reduce the look temporarily by improving skin texture and hydration, but they rarely eliminate deeper fat chambers that cause cellulite.
How long should I use a cellulite cream before expecting visible changes?
Most users notice subtle improvements in firmness after 4 to 6 weeks of consistent daily application, with best results when paired with movement and proper hydration.
Can caffeine in creams permanently remove cellulite fat?
No, caffeine only provides a short-term reduction in water retention and does not destroy fat cells permanently.
Are there any risks or side effects with long term use of cellulite creams?
Some people may experience mild irritation, redness, or sensitivity to ingredients like retinol, so it is wise to patch test and follow usage guidelines.
